Getting started with a Virtual IOP is straightforward. Programs typically consist of 9-20 hours of structured therapy each week, with sessions available 3-5 days a week, lasting 3-4 hours each. Licensed therapists and counselors conduct individual, group, and family sessions through secure, HIPAA-compliant video conferencing.
